The Minister for Europe and Foreign Affairs of Albania Ditmir Bushati visited Astana, which became the first official visit of a foreign minister from Albania to Kazakhstan in the history of bilateral relations, reports the press service of Kazakh Foreign Ministry.

During the conversation with Foreign Minister Kairat Abdrakhmanov, the parties discussed in detail the state and prospects of political, trade, economic and cultural relationship. Construction, energy, agriculture, transport, infrastructure, logistics and tourism were identified as promising areas of cooperation.

The Albanian delegation was informed about the favorable conditions and preferences for foreign investors in Kazakhstan, as well as opportunities for collaboration in the framework of the Astana International Financial Center.

The trade turnover between the two countries remains low. Therefore, in order to advance trade and economic relations, an agreement was reached to accelerate the process of signing three fundamental agreements: on trade and economic cooperation, on the promotion and mutual protection of investments and on avoidance of double taxation. In addition, documents on mutual legal assistance are on the agenda of negotiations.

In this context, the personal contribution of President of Kazakhstan Nursultan Nazarbayev to the settlement of international conflicts was emphasized, as well as the initiatives of the head of Kazakhstan in the framework of The Astana Club - updating the Helsinki process in 1975 and holding a conference on security and cooperation in Astana in 2020, as well as the first joint consultative meeting of the OSCE, the CICA and the ASEAN Regional Forum.

During the talks, the Kazakh side also expressed its readiness to support the candidacy of Albania for the OSCE chairmanship in 2020 and to share the experience of its chairmanship in this organization.

Following the meeting, the diplomats signed a Protocol on Cooperation between the Ministries of Foreign Affairs, and also adopted a Memorandum on Cooperation between the Chambers of Commerce.

Within the framework of Bushati's visit, meetings are also scheduled with the Senate of the Parliament of Kazakhstan, the Government, the Ministry of Investment and Development and National Company Kazakh Invest JSC, as well as a meeting in the Chamber of Commerce “Atameken".
